1989 Holden Nova vs. 1989 Wartburg 1.3 l Tourist

To start off, both 1989 Holden Nova and 1989 Wartburg 1.3 l Tourist were released in the same year (1989).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 1,397 cc (4 cylinders), 1989 Holden Nova is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1989 Holden Nova (81 HP) has 24 more horse power than 1989 Wartburg 1.3 l Tourist. (57 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1989 Holden Nova should accelerate faster than 1989 Wartburg 1.3 l Tourist.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1989 Holden Nova weights approximately 65 kg more than 1989 Wartburg 1.3 l Tourist.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1989 Holden Nova (118 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 22 more torque (in Nm) than 1989 Wartburg 1.3 l Tourist. (96 Nm @ 3300 RPM). This means 1989 Holden Nova will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1989 Wartburg 1.3 l Tourist.
